
Bill Flores bought Western Digital Corporation (NASDAQ: WDC)
Bill Flores (R-TX), a U.S. Representative, has disclosed 3 trades in Western Digital Corporation (WDC) since 2019, 2 purchases and 1 sale, worth an estimated $33K in disclosed volume (the midpoint of the dollar ranges members report, not exact amounts).
The trade highlighted here is a purchase: Bill Flores bought Unknown of Western Digital Corporation (NASDAQ: WDC) on March 25, 2019. Since that trade, WDC is up +1458.24% against the S&P 500 up +195.07%, an outperformance of +1263.17%.
Across these filings, Bill Flores has been a net buyer of WDC (a buy-to-sell ratio of 2.00). The most recent disclosed WDC transaction shown was dated August 7, 2019. Each row in the table below links to that trade and its post-trade performance versus the market.

Is it legal for Bill Flores to trade Western Digital Corporation (WDC) stock?
Yes. Members of Congress are allowed to trade individual stocks, including Western Digital Corporation (WDC), but the STOCK Act of 2012 requires them to publicly disclose each transaction within 45 days. Quantellect tracks those disclosures; this page does not imply the trade was improper.

How soon must members of Congress disclose a trade?
Under the STOCK Act, members of Congress must publicly report a covered transaction within 45 days of the trade. Filings can still be delayed, amended, or contain errors.
